Abstract

The present invention relates to be related to teaching simulation sand table field, specifically a kind of rail traffic electrification sand table, it include to show that sand table, sand table elevating mechanism, angle adjusting mechanism and Rail Transit System show mechanism, the Rail Transit System shows that mechanism includes to show track, show station, light fixture, show massif and elevated bridge component, the tunnel passed through for showing track is offered on the displaying massif, angle adjusting mechanism includes being equipped with support shaft in each supporting vertical plate there are two supporting vertical plate.The beneficial effects of the invention are as follows can make to show that sand table is watched in different angles for learner by angle adjusting mechanism, the gradient of support bridge plate can be adjusted by gradient regulating member, the height for showing sand table can be adjusted by sand table elevating mechanism, enable to show that sand table is gone up and down in the vertical direction, can be watched in suitable height for learner and teacher.

Referring to figs. 1 to Fig. 9 it is found that a kind of rail traffic electrification sand table, includes to show sand table 1, sand table elevating mechanism 2, angle adjusting mechanism 3 and the Rail Transit System being arranged at the top of displaying sand table 1 show mechanism 4, and the displaying sand table 1 is arranged On angle adjusting mechanism 3, the bottom of angle adjusting mechanism 3, the Rail Transit System is arranged in the sand table elevating mechanism 2 Show that mechanism 4 includes to show track 4a, show station 4b, light fixture 6, show massif 4c and elevated bridge component 5, it is described Show that the outer surface of track 4a is coated with anti oxidation layer, the light fixture 6 is arranged at the center for showing sand table 1, the displaying Track 4a is laid on the top for showing sand table 1, described to show the tunnel 4d for offering on massif 4c and passing through for showing track 4a, institute State angle adjusting mechanism 3 include there are two in be equipped on the supporting vertical plate 3a, each supporting vertical plate 3a that are vertically arranged with Its support shaft 3b being rotatablely connected, the displaying sand table 1 are fixed between two support shaft 3b;Teacher is adjusted by the gradient The gradient of support bridge plate 5c2 can be adjusted in component 5c, make teacher that can will connect track 5c3 by rail joint manually It is attached with track 4a is shown, so that test carriage is sailed in the enterprising every trade of the bridge of different gradient, pass through sand table elevator Structure 2 can adjust the height for showing sand table 1, enable to show that sand table 1 is gone up and down in the vertical direction, pass through angular adjustment machine Structure 3 can make to show that sand table 1 is watched in different angles for learner, enable learner just can be to exhibition without walking about Show being watched totally for sand table 1, can make LED illumination lamp 6a in different angle and directions to experiment by light fixture 6 Trolley is illuminated, and can will be shown track 4a by Rail Transit System displaying mechanism 4 and will be shown inside and outside the 4b of station Situation shows learner to watch, convenient for carrying out simulation teching to learner.
The angle adjusting mechanism 3 further include have rotary electric machine 3c, two be separately positioned on show 1 both ends bottom of sand table It is equipped on the rotary shaft 3e, the rotary shaft 3e being rotatablely connected with the two and is arranged between ring gear 3d, two supporting vertical plate 3a There are two transmission gear 3f, each transmission gear 3f corresponding ring gear a 3d, the transmission gear 3f and corresponding Ring gear 3d be meshed, the rotary electric machine 3c is installed therein on the side wall of a supporting vertical plate 3a, and rotary electric machine It is connected between the output end and rotary shaft 3e of 3c by shaft coupling;It can make to show sand table 1 in difference by angle adjusting mechanism 3 Angle watched for learner, enable learner be not necessarily to walk about just can to show sand table 1 totally watch, side Learner learn, improve the learning efficiency of learner, rotary electric machine 3c work can drive rotary shaft 3e to occur Rotation enables rotary shaft 3e to rotate around the axis of its own, so that rotary shaft 3e is able to drive transmission gear 3f rotation, makes to be driven Gear 3f is able to drive the ring gear 3d rotation engaged, is able to drive ring gear 3d and shows that sand table 1 is rotated, makes to show husky Disk 1 can be rotated around the axis of support shaft 3b, enable to show that sand table 1 carries out rotation in a certain range and sees convenient for learner It sees.
The sand table elevating mechanism 2 includes workbench 2a and two slide guide components being arranged at intervals at the top of workbench 2a 2b, two slide guide component 2b structures are identical and include axle sleeve 2b1 and two intervals and the fluctuating orbit being vertically arranged 2b2, each supporting vertical plate 3a correspond to two fluctuating orbit 2b2, and the setting that the supporting vertical plate 3a can be slided is two Between a fluctuating orbit 2b2, on connecting plate 2b3 with outward extension on the side wall of the supporting vertical plate 3a, the axle sleeve 2b1 Equipped in the drive lead screw 2c for being vertically arranged and running through workbench 2a, the connecting plate 2b3 is equipped with and drive lead screw 2c is passed The screw of dynamic connection;The height for showing sand table 1 can be adjusted by sand table elevating mechanism 2, enable to show sand table 1 in vertical side It is gone up and down upwards, can be watched in suitable height for learner and teacher, meet the study of different heights Under the action of driving force drive lead screw 2c can rotate person's demand, the drive lead screw 2c company of being able to drive in the course of rotation Fishplate bar 2b3 vertical shift makes connecting plate 2b3 be able to drive supporting vertical plate 3a vertical sliding, and two fluctuating orbit 2b2 can be to branch Support vertical plate 3a plays the role of guiding, and supporting vertical plate 3a can drive during lifting shows that sand table 1 is gone up and down, and goes up and down Track 2b2 is fixedly connected by bolt with workbench 2a.
The sand table elevating mechanism 2 further includes that there are two the mounting base 2d for being arranged at intervals on the bottom workbench 2a, two institutes It states spaced there are two being arranged on the transmission shaft 2e, the transmission shaft 2e for being equipped between mounting base 2d and being rotatablely connected with the two First bevel gear 2f, the bottom of each drive lead screw 2c are arranged with second bevel gear 2g, each first bevel gear 2f corresponding second bevel gear a 2g, the first bevel gear 2f and corresponding second bevel gear 2g are meshed, described The end sleeve of transmission shaft 2e is equipped with handwheel 2h;Teacher rotates handwheel 2h manually can make transmission shaft 2e rotate, transmission shaft 2e It is able to drive two first bevel gear 2f while rotating, two first bevel gear 2f is enable to drive two second cones respectively Gear 2g rotates, and two drive lead screw 2c is enable to rotate synchronously, can be according to reality by the way of manually driving Border service condition quickly adjusts the height for showing sand table 1.
The light fixture 6 includes LED illumination lamp 6a, fixed square tube 6b and the bearing shown at the top of sand table 1 is arranged in Seat 6b1, the rotating cylinder 6b2 being rotatablely connected with it is equipped on each bearing block 6b1, and the fixed square tube 6b is vertically arranged At the top of rotating cylinder 6b2, the top of the fixed square tube 6b is equipped with attachment base 6b3, and the attachment base 6b3 is equipped with and its turn Cursor 6c is arranged on the installation axle 6b4, the installation axle 6b4 of dynamic connection, the end of the cursor 6c is equipped with lampshade 6d, The LED illumination lamp 6a is arranged in the lampshade 6d;LED illumination lamp 6a can be made in different angles by light fixture 6 Test carriage is illuminated with direction, test carriage is enable to be travelled under the irradiation of light, it is more that no setting is required Headlamp has saved instruction cost, and for cursor 6c for installing to lampshade 6d, lampshade 6d can play the role of optically focused.
The light fixture 6 further includes having the stepper motor 6e for being arranged in and showing 1 bottom of sand table, the stepper motor 6e's Output end is arranged upward vertically, and the lower section of the rotating cylinder 6b2 is arranged with driven gear 6e1, the output end of institute stepper motor 6e On be arranged with driving gear 6e2, the driving gear 6e2 is meshed with driven gear 6e1;Stepper motor 6e work can drive Driving gear 6e2 rotation, driving gear 6e2 are able to drive the driven gear 6e1 rotation engaged, enable driven gear 6e1 It enough drives rotating cylinder 6b2 to rotate around the axis of its own, LED illumination lamp 6a is enable to be illuminated in different directions.
It is in horizontally disposed connecting rod 6e3 that the end of the cursor 6c, which is equipped with, is set on the side wall of the fixed square tube 6b There are the top of the fixed frame 6e4, the fixed frame 6e4 that are firmly connected with it to be equipped with hinged seat 6e5, is set on the hinged seat 6e5 There are adjusting the electric cylinders 6e6, the output end that adjusts electric cylinders 6e6 and connecting rod 6e3 hinged with it hinged;Adjusting electric cylinders 6e6 Under the action of can drive connection bar 6e3 it is mobile, so that connecting rod 6e3 is able to drive cursor 6c and turn around the axis of installation axle 6b4 It is dynamic, so that cursor 6c is able to drive LED illumination lamp 6a and rotated around the axis of installation axle 6b4, enables LED illumination lamp 6a in difference Angle to test carriage carry out lighting homework.
Lake 4e and residential quarters 4f is equipped at the top of the displaying sand table 1, the residential quarters 4f shines equipped with cold light source Fire resistant coating is coated on the side wall of bright lamp, the workbench 2a and supporting vertical plate 3a;Fire resistant coating can play the role of fireproof, cold Light source illuminating lamp can issue light, keep residential quarters 4f more true to nature.
The elevated bridge component 5 includes overhead stage body 5a, overhead station 5b and two gradient tune being symmetrical set Component 5c is saved, the side of overhead stage body 5a is arranged in the overhead station 5b, and the bottom of the overhead stage body 5a is equipped with padded plate 5c1, two gradient regulating member 5c structures are identical and include support bridge plate 5c2 and support bridge plate 5c2 for adjusting The regulating part 7 of the gradient, the top of the support bridge plate 5c2 be equipped with for the connection track 5c3 that shows that track 4a is connect, it is described The end for connecting track 5c3 is equipped with rail joint, described to show that sand table 1 is equipped with the mounting groove 5d for support bridge plate 5c2 installation, One end of the support bridge plate 5c2 and the slot bottom of mounting groove 5d are hinged;Teacher can be to support bridge by gradient regulating member 5c The gradient of plate 5c2 is adjusted, and makes teacher that can will connect track 5c3 by rail joint manually and connects with track 4a is shown It connects, test carriage is enable to sail in the enterprising every trade of the bridge of different gradient, when supporting the gradient of bridge plate 5c2 to adjust, religion Teacher can adjustable track connector according to the actual situation installation site, enable rail joint that will connect track in place 5c3 is connect with track 4a is shown, can adjust overhead stage body 5a by the way that multiple padded plate 5c1 are arranged in the bottom of overhead stage body 5a Height, enable displaying track 4a at the top of overhead stage body 5a suitable height with connect track 5c3 and be connected.
The regulating part 7 includes the fixed plate 7b for adjusting that motor 7a and two are arranged at intervals in mounting groove 5d, described It adjusts motor 7a and the bottom for showing sand table 1 is set, be equipped between two fixed plate 7b and adjust screw rod 7c and two guiding Bar 7d, the adjusting screw rod 7c and two rail joint fixed plate 7b are rotatablely connected, be arranged on the adjusting screw rod 7c and its The feed block 7e of threaded connection, the bottom of the support bridge plate 5c2 are equipped with extending seat 7g, and the top of the feed block 7e is equipped with branch Seat 7f is supportted, the driver plate 7h hinged with the two, the end for adjusting screw rod 7c are equipped between the support base 7f and extending seat 7g Portion is arranged with third hand tap gear 7i, and the 4th cone engaged with third hand tap gear 7i is arranged on the output end for adjusting motor 7a Gear 7j;Adjusting motor 7a work can drive the 4th bevel gear 7j to rotate, and the 4th bevel gear 7j, which is able to drive, to be engaged Third hand tap gear 7i rotation, third hand tap gear 7i, which is able to drive, adjusts screw rod 7c rotation, and adjusting screw rod 7c is made to be able to drive charging Block 7e is moved, and feed block 7e is enable to move horizontally on guide rod 7d, and feed block 7e is able to drive support base 7f generation It is mobile, so that support base 7f is able to drive the driver plate 7h hinged with it and moved, driver plate 7h is made to be able to drive extending seat 7g It is mobile, to enable that bridge plate 5c2 is supported to be rotated within the scope of certain amplitude.
